肾功能不全患者N端B型脑利钠肽前体和肌红蛋白水平的变化及临床意义 被引量:1

Change and clinical significance of N-terminal brain natriuretic peptide precursor and myoglobin in patients with renal insufficiency

摘要 目的探讨肾功能不全患者N端B型脑利钠肽前体(NT-proBNP)和肌红蛋白水平的变化及临床意义。方法根据美国慢性肾脏病分期,利用估算肾小球滤过率(eGFR)水平将389例肾科住院患者分为五组:A组41例,eGFR≥90 mL·min^-1·1.73m^-2;B组34例,60 mL·min^-1·1.73m^-2≤eGFR<90 mL·min^-1·1.73m^-2;C组65例,30 mL·min^-1·1.73m^-2≤eGFR<60 mL·min^-1·1.73m^-2;D组104例,15 mL·min^-1·1.73m^-2≤eGFR<30 mL·min^-1·1.73m^-2;E组145例,eGFR<15 mL·min^-1·1.73m^-2。比较五组患者NT-proBNP和肌红蛋白水平,分析NT-proBNP和肌红蛋白与SCr和eGFR的相关性。结果A、B、C、D和E组NT-proBNP水平分别为247.4(86.1,1494.5)ng/L、431.7(124.3,1387.0)ng/L、621.7(234.5,3404.5)ng/L、1568.0(620.9,5440.3)ng/L和8571.0(4914.0,15832.5)ng/L,肌红蛋白水平分别为19.0(14.0,26.5)μg/L、22.5(18.5,35.3)μg/L、51.0(29.5,107.0)μg/L、56.0(37.5,86.8)μg/L和110.0(76.0,182.5)μg/L。E组NT-proBNP和肌红蛋白水平高于C、D组(P<0.05)。NT-proBNP和肌红蛋白均与SCr呈正相关(rs=0.631和0.620,P<0.05),与eGFR呈负相关(rs=-0.640和-0.601,P<0.05)。结论NT-proBNP和肌红蛋白水平随着肾脏疾病的进展而增加,动态检测有助于早期发现肾功能不全患者的心血管疾病。 Objective To investigate the change and clinical significance of N-terminal brain natriuretic peptide precursor(NT-proBNP)and myoglobin in the patients with renal insufficiency.Methods According to the US CKD staging,389 hospitalized patients in nephrology department were divided into five groups of A(eGFR≥90 mL·min^-1·1.73 m^-2,41 cases),B(60 mL·min^-1·1.73 m^-2≤eGFR<90 mL·min^-1·1.73 m^-2,34 cases),C(30 mL·min^-1·1.73 m^-2≤eGFR<60 mL·min^-1·1.73 m^-2,65 cases),D(15 mL·min^-1·1.73 m^-2≤eGFR<30 mL·min^-1·1.73 m^-2,104 cases)and E(eGFR<15 mL·min^-1·1.73 m^-2,145 cases).The levels of NT-proBNP and myoglobin were compared among five groups,and the correlations of NT-proBNP and myoglobin with SCr and eGFR were analyzed.Results The NT-proBNP level in groups of A,B,C,D and E was 247.4(86.1,1494.5)ng/L,431.7(124.3,1387.0)ng/L,621.7(234.5,3404.5)ng/L,1568.0(620.9,5440.3)ng/L and 8571.0(4914.0,15832.5)ng/L,respectively.The myoglobin level in groups of A,B,C,D and E was 19.0(14.0,26.5)μg/L,22.5(18.5,35.3)μg/L,51.0(29.5,107.0)μg/L,56.0(37.5,86.8)μg/L and 110.0(76.0,182.5)μg/L,respectively.The levels of NT-proBNP and myoglobin were higher in group E than those in groups of C and D(P<0.05).NT-proBNP and myoglobinin were positively correlated with SCr(rs=0.631 and 0.620,P<0.05)and negatively correlated with eGFR(rs=-0.640 and-0.601,P<0.05).Conclusion The levels of NT-proBNP and myoglobin are increased with the progression of kidney disease,which is helpful for early detection of cardiovascular diseases in the patients with renal insufficiency.
